Why is Zoology Good?

Published in Animal Science 3 mins read

Zoology is valuable because it fosters a deep understanding of animals and their crucial role in the natural world. It goes beyond mere observation and delves into the intricate connections between animals, their habitats, and the broader environment.

Benefits of Studying Zoology

Studying zoology offers a myriad of benefits, impacting not only our understanding of the animal kingdom but also our approach to environmental conservation. Here are some key advantages:

  • Understanding Environmental Impacts: Zoology helps us understand how environmental changes affect different animals and their habitats. This understanding is vital for conservation efforts. The reference states, "Zoology considers the impact of environmental factors upon different animals and their habitats..." This highlights the core contribution of zoology in environmental science.
  • Appreciating Nature's Importance: It fosters a deep appreciation for the natural world and the critical role animals and their environments play in sustaining life as we know it.
  • Informed Conservation Efforts: By understanding animal behaviors, ecosystems, and threats, zoologists are crucial for developing strategies to protect endangered species and preserve biodiversity.
  • Medical and Scientific Advancements: Research in zoology has led to significant breakthroughs in medicine, agriculture, and other fields, as studies of animal biology frequently provide insights into human biology and disease mechanisms.
  • Ecological Balance: Zoology emphasizes the importance of understanding the delicate balance of ecosystems and the impact of human activity on them.

Key Contributions of Zoology

Zoology makes substantial contributions to:

Area Contribution
Ecology Understanding how animals interact with their environment and other species.
Medicine Advancements in disease treatment and prevention via animal model studies.
Conservation Development of strategies to protect endangered species and their habitats.
Agriculture Better understanding of animal behavior for improved livestock management and food production practices.
Education Promoting appreciation and awareness of nature and the importance of animal welfare.
